What is QuickBooks Online?

QuickBooks Online is a SaaS verison of the QuickBooks product. It contains all of the features found in the local version, features typical of similarly priced accounting software. The monthly fee for this service starts at $10 and climbs to $30 with the Plus version, which has the richest features. The base level allows for unlimited invoices and estimates, expense tracking, importing from Excel or Quickbooks desktop, data backup, mobile accessibility, and integration with many other applications. The Essentials pricing plan contain more automation, more bill and payment management, as well as inventory and time tracking, and the Plus package contains budgeting and analytic features.

BEWARE!! If you use Quickbooks bill pay service, Intuit and the service provider Melio will take your money out of your account and put it in their account at Silicon Valley Bank and you may not get it back ever. My story, I paid a vendor with a check for over $16,000, supposedly the check was stolen and deposited into Chase bank. I tried for 3 months now to get Intuit or Melio to tell me where our funds are, show me an affidavit they filed, anything. Myself and our CFO have over 25 calls into each and over 10 emails, even threating to come to NY to get it straight with the owners. They do not answer the phone at Melio, maybe 1 in 26 times calling and they will not let you talk to anyone in their operations or other divisions. The customer service agents are just shields for their company. I called Intuit(whose name is on the check along with their phone number) one day and got a guy named Bright who told me that he had our $16k right there and he would process a refund to us and we never got it. Now Intuit says they don't know where the money is. If you don't understand that the money leaves your bank and goes into Intuit and Melio. Quickbooks staff does not even know how to describe what happens when you ask them.
